perf intel-pt: Synthesize CFE (Control Flow Event) / EVD (Event Data) event



Synthesize an attribute event and sample events for Intel PT Event Trace
events represented by CFE and EVD packets.

Committer notes:

Make 'struct perf_synth_intel_evd evd[]' evd[0] at the end of 'struct
perf_synth_intel_evt' as it is breaking the build with in many compilers
with (e.g. clang version 13.0.0 (Fedora 13.0.0-3.fc35)):

  util/intel-pt.c:2213:31: error: field 'cfe' with variable sized type 'struct perf_synth_intel_evt' not at the end of a struct or class is a GNU extension [-Werror,-Wgnu-variable-sized-type-not-at-end]
                  struct perf_synth_intel_evt cfe;
                                              ^
